Excerpt from The Mammals of South Africa, Vol. 1: Primates, Carnivora and Ungulata; With a Map and Illustrations

IT seems a very remarkable fact, in these days of books and book-making, that except for one very creditable essay published in 1832, by Mr. J. F. Smuts, no one has hitherto attempted to''give a complete account of the Mammals of South Africa; and although large numbers of naturalists and sportsmen have visited the country, for the purpose of shooting and collecting, nearly all their energies have been devoted to obtaining so-called trophies of the larger animals; While the smaller sorts, among Which are many most interesting creatures, have been hitherto almost entirely neglected.

The result of this is that our knowledge of the larger animals such as the antelopes and the carnivores, is fairly complete, While among the rats, bats, and shrews, much still remains to be done.

In the present volumes I have endeavoured to collect together all the information at present available on the subject ''of South African Mammals. I fear there are -a_ good many omissions and that much revision will be necessary, but my hope is, that the publication of this book may stimulate the energy of many interested in Natural History to collect further material and to record more facts about the life-history of South African animals, for it is the want of specimens, and of information regarding them, that has so much hampered me in my present efforts.
